Item 5.07Submission of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ders.

 

On August 30, 2022, Daybreak Oil and Gas, Inc. (OCT PINK:DBRM), a Washington corporation (“Daybreak” or the “Company”), held an Annual Meeting of Shareholders,

 

At the Annual Meeting, 348,541,779 of the Company’s 384,735,402 issued and outstanding shares of common stock entitled to vote, or approximately 90% as of the record date, July 7, 2022, were present or represented by proxy.

 

The final voting results on the proposals presented for stockholder approval at the Special Meeting were as follows:

 

Proposal No. 1: The shareholders ELECTED the following four (4) directors nominated by our Board of Directors to the Daybreak Board of Directors, to serve until the Company’s next Annual Meeting of Shareholders, or until their earlier, death, resignation, or removal:

Nominee Votes For Votes Withheld Abstentions Broker Non-Votes
   James F. Westmoreland 335,976,085 200,333 0 12,365,361
   Timothy R. Lindsey 335,976,085 200,333 0 12,365,361
   James F. Meara 335,976,085 200,333 0 12,365,361
   Darren Williams 336,173,884 2,534 0 12,365,361

 

 

Proposal 2: The shareholders RATIFIED our appointment of MaloneBailey, LLP as our independent registered public accountants for the fiscal year ending February 28, 2023; and

Votes For Votes Against Abstentions Broker Non-Votes
348,458,192 53,882 29,705 0
